Marlon Jackson was born on March 12, 1957, in Gary, Indiana. He is the second eldest of the famous Jackson siblings, who collectively became one of the most successful musical families in history. Marlon began his career at a young age, performing with his brothers in local talent shows before they formed The Jackson 5. The group went on to achieve staggering success in the 1970s, producing hits such as "I Want You Back" and "ABC." Over the years, Marlon has also released solo albums and collaborated with various artists, contributing his unique style to the music industry.

Marlon Jackson's influence on the music industry extends beyond his performances. As a member of The Jackson 5, he played a crucial role in shaping the sound of Motown and paving the way for future generations of artists. The group's success showcased the talent of young African-American performers, breaking barriers and changing the landscape of popular music.
After The Jackson 5 disbanded in the late 1970s, Marlon Jackson embarked on a solo career that allowed him to explore his artistic vision. He released his debut solo album, "Baby Tonight," in 1987, showcasing his versatility as an artist. The album featured a mix of R&B and pop, receiving positive reviews and solidifying Marlon's place in the music industry.
Throughout the years, Marlon has continued to release music, collaborate with other artists, and perform live. His solo work often reflects his personal experiences and growth, allowing fans to connect with him on a deeper level.
